cleartext vs text file

cleartext

noun
  • The unencrypted form of an encrypted text; plain text 

text file

noun
  • A data file containing only plain, human-readable text, distinct from documents with embedded formatting 

  • A data file in a character encoding that allows it to be read in non-specialised text editor.
